Redondoviridae

From WikiMD.com Medical Encyclopedia

Family of viruses



Redondoviridae is a family of single-stranded DNA viruses that have been identified in human respiratory tract samples. These viruses are characterized by their small, circular DNA genomes and are part of the CRESS-DNA virus group, which stands for "circular Rep-encoding single-stranded DNA viruses". The family includes two genera: Vientovirus and Brisavirus.

Genome[edit | edit source]

Genome map of Redondoviridae

The genome of Redondoviridae is circular and consists of approximately 3,000 nucleotides. It encodes two main proteins: the replication-associated protein (Rep) and the capsid protein (Cap). The Rep protein is involved in the replication of the viral genome, while the Cap protein forms the protective shell around the viral DNA.

Structure[edit | edit source]

Redondoviruses are non-enveloped viruses with icosahedral symmetry. The capsid is composed of the Cap protein, which assembles into a protective structure around the viral genome. The small size and simple structure of these viruses are typical of the CRESS-DNA virus group.

Discovery and Epidemiology[edit | edit source]

Redondoviruses were first identified in 2019 through metagenomic sequencing of human respiratory tract samples. They have been found in both healthy individuals and those with respiratory illnesses, although their exact role in disease is not yet fully understood. The prevalence of redondoviruses in the human population and their potential impact on health are areas of ongoing research.

Pathogenesis[edit | edit source]

The pathogenic potential of redondoviruses is still under investigation. While they have been detected in individuals with respiratory conditions, it is unclear whether they are causative agents of disease or simply commensal organisms. Further studies are needed to elucidate their role in human health and disease.
